Excellent liver enzyme levels, Jake, when the numbers drop like that it`s a good indication that there`s a lot less inflammation going on in your liver. 

The treatment is clearly working well and your liver is feeling much happier already!  smile

hey all, 1 1/2 months into the treatment (sovaldi/ribavirin) and just got the results from my 1st. blood test. they didn't test the viral load but my enzyme levels have dropped from AST level at 286 to 29 , and the ALT level from 356 to 30! both in the normal range. my dr. says she is very optimistic.not sure when they will do a viral load test but am hoping for the best. so far other than a little sickness from time to time ,the side effects have not been too bad and haven't experienced the depression or itching skin that others have so counting my blessings! wishing the best for all of us... carry on!
